Output 80c210aa8833c01939e9128025fc63b5c7fd9f1f9ec2fb163280b8f6a8f5e1f9:9

value
5300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af4b822866d58044d443e4586939028d4a3f4582 OP_EQUAL
address
3HftdXntTYVH99tGLmqQoF4RdMM7PX7aen
transaction
80c210aa8833c01939e9128025fc63b5c7fd9f1f9ec2fb163280b8f6a8f5e1f9
spent
true